The area of business development is a central interface between institutes, board and administration of the research centre. The implementation of innovation and transfer, the support of national and international cooperation and the promotion of young scientists are essential services for research. The scientific adequate controlling department (UE-C) is responsible for the key figures of the research centre, which are transmitted to grantors in mandatory reports or published in internal and external reports. In addition, the programmatic planning is located within the framework of the program-oriented promotion of the Helmholtz Association at UE-C. In investment management, UE-C is responsible for central investment planning within the research centre. The first priority of your task is the central investment planning within the Research Centre and therefore the responsibility for the centrally funded Structural and Development Fund (STEF) You will demonstrate your cooperative skills by providing support for expansion investments > 2.5 million euros in close coordination with the scientific institutes and the Financial and Controlling department (F). In addition, in cooperation with science and the research management department (UE-F), you will coordinate the Jülich participation in the Strategic Investments Process > 15 million Euro of the Helmholtz Association New large-scale projects, despite additional funding, usually have a significant internal financing requirement, often over a long period of time, and must be planned early and permanently. The coordination of these financing needs within the framework of kick-off meetings is your responsibility In the second focus of your task, you support the department management in all questions concerning the programmatic controlling of the research centre You accompany the programmatic aspects of internal planning and reporting You shall ensure that appeals and other special circumstances are taken into account in the context of internal financial planning.
